Car Hire for one day from Disney
We are going to Busch Gardens and I have realised that it would be cheaper to hire a car for one day than it would be to get an Uber. We are staying at Pop Century Resort. Where can I pick up a car and how would I manage to hire the likes of a Mustang or Camaro?

The Disney Car Care Center would be the best location to collect from. They'll send a shuttle to your hotel reception to collection you (they open at 6am). Just ask your reception to give them a call the day before to arrange a suitable colleciton time.
Mustang and Camaro fall under the convertible category. Just be aware that August is hot & sunny and if you drive to Busch Gardens with the roof down, you'll be burnt to a crisp. |

We had a Mustang last week which was organised through Alamo at Dolphin hotel. It was about $150 for 2 days and they sent a shuttle to collect us from our resort as described above and you just give the keys to the valet there on return.
Don’t forget to add on parking and toll charges. (Apparently Disney charge $25 per night- but somehow we weren’t charged). |
